Fact and Rumor.

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

There will be no lecture in Physics B today.

Theme X in English B. was returned yesterday.

The lacrosse team goes to the training table today.

There will be an hour examination in Political Economy 4 today.

The preliminary speaking for the Boylston prizes will take place on May 3d.

M. Chevreul, the French chemist who died lately at the age of 103, was an L. L. D. of Harvard, having received that degree at the quarter millenial celebration in 1886.

Hammond Lamont '86, is the new managing editor of the Albany Express.

The cricket club has obtained permission to practice on the grounds of the Harvard Polo club.

The examinations for second year and final honors in classics take place on May 4, 6, and June 5 and 12.

Mr. Bolles has been unable to be at the office since last Saturday on account of an injury to one of his eyes.

Professor A. S. Hill will be in Sever 1 this afternoon from 3 to 4, to meet students desiring to compete for the Boylston prizes.

Yale was defeated by the Washington league team on Monday by a score of 5 to 0. Stagg and Poole formed Yale's battery.

The Phillips Andover nine has games arranged with Harvard, Princeton, Amherst, Williams, the Beacons and other strong teams.

By the will of the late P. P. Norris of Philadelphia, the University of Pennsylvania receives his extensive law library, valued at $190.000.

General Washington received the degree of L. L. D. from Harvard in 1776, from Yale in 1781, from Pennsylvania and Brown in 1790.

The men in N. H. 5 will take a trip to Nahant and Lynn Beach today to look for marine specimens under the direction of Mr. Parker. They will take the nine o'clock train on the Eastern R. R.

Ex-Governor John S. Pillsbury on Monday presented $150,000 to the Minnesota State University, for which the Legislature made an inadequate appropriation.
